Victoria Beckham has opened up about her difficult transition from global pop star to fashion designer. The Spice Girls alum detailed her struggles in a new Netflix documentary series. She described feeling lost and creatively unfulfilled after the group’s split.
Her candid revelations explain the motivation behind her drastic career change. According to The Sun, Beckham credits designer Roland Mouret with advising her to “just be me.”
From Pop Stardom to Fashion Industry Skepticism
Beckham’s journey into fashion was met with industry skepticism. She recalled how Vogue editor Anna Wintour initially declined invitations to her shows. Wintour admitted in the documentary to being skeptical of celebrity designers.
The former singer faced significant financial challenges while building her brand. Reports confirmed her fashion house was millions of pounds in debt. David Beckham had invested heavily but expressed concern about sustainability.
Personal Struggles and Business Transformation
The documentary reveals Beckham’s personal battles with body image and public scrutiny. She described controlling her weight in an “incredibly unhealthy way” during her pop career. These struggles influenced her design philosophy and brand identity.
Her business eventually turned around with new investment and restructuring. Investor David Belhassen helped identify wasteful spending, including excessive office plant maintenance. The brand finally became profitable in 2022 after years of financial struggle.
